"Food for Sloth" by Carol Krenz

# 83973
This paper discusses the article "Food for Sloth" by Carol Krenz, which discusses the way carbohydrates and sugar effect the brain.
1,125 words (approx. 4.5 pages) | 1 source | 2005 | United States
Published on: Jan 01, 2005

Paper Summary:

This paper explains that Carol Krenz' research explores the way sugar and carbohydrates stimulate differing parts of the brain. The author points out that, by realizing the soothing powers of both sugar and carbohydrates, there can be little doubt that both offer a solution to depression in the winter. The paper relates that, by keeping a balance of both of these necessary dietary factors, relief from depression can be found without hazardous health problems, which each one may provide singularly.

From the Paper:

"The article "Food for Sloth" by Carol Krenz begins with an argument that presents the similarities between comfort' foods and hibernation foods. This manner of food related analysis present the dietary and psychological process that leads to excessive sugar and carbohydrates in the winter months. The beginning pars of the article tell how human beings have a tendency to eat more sugars due to the normative depressive states that occur between December and March. The article then begins to discuss the indifference between comfort foods and hibernation that exist, but not without the `poisoning' that sugar and carbohydrates can impart on the human body in a singular manner."
